Prime Minister's Literary Award Winners 2024

The winners of the 2024 Prime Minister's Literary Awards were announced this week. These awards have a significant prize pool ($600K) and serve to recognise 'established and emerging Australia writers, illustrators, poets and historians'. 

The winners are:

  • FICTION - Andre Dao - Anam
  • NON-FICTION - Daniel Browning - Close to the Subject: Selected Works
  • AUSTRALIAN HISTORY - Ryan Cropp - Donald Horne: A Life in the Lucky Country
  • CHILDREN'S LITERATURE - Violet Wadrill (and co-creators) -  Tamarra: A Story of Termites on Gurindji Country
  • YOUNG ADULT LITERATURE - Will Kostakis - We Could Be Something
  • POETRY - Amy Crutchfield - The Cyprian
